Не скучные часы на WS2812B

Обсуждаем контроллеры компании Atmel.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Mishany, в архиве прошивка V4!
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

Mishany писал(а):наверное похоже, моя плата выше под V5 прошивку

По ней и делал. Буду плату править.
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

Поправил.
Вложения
Нескучные часы на WS2812B.rar
(353.75 КБ) 516 скачиваний
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

max50,на плате разьем 5pin (правый верх), для чего?
Изображение

Добавлено after 1 hour 50 minutes 56 seconds:
Сегодня по барометру 755мм.рт.ст.! У меня на табло Р 835!
Это можно скорректировать? (Датчики DS18B20 не подключены).
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

dimonvlg писал(а):разьем 5pin (правый верх), для чего?

Для подключения программатора, если в МК "залит" бутлоадер ардуины.
dimonvlg писал(а):У меня на табло Р 835!

Датчик точно BME280? У меня все нормально показывает уже пол года.

Точек для даты не планируется?
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

У меня BMP280 и запускается через раз, не пойму в чем дело.
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

max50 писал(а):Датчик точно BME280?

Найдите отличие.
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Где поподробнее прочитать про бутлоадер ардуины?
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

ХЗ. Через поиск поищите. Можно посмотреть на arduino.ru.
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Вопрос: после 30 секунд показа времени, идет опрос датчиков.
У-32 С подключен ds18b20
П-28 С подключен 3231
H-0%
P-758 подключен BMP280

На выводы контроллера 10, 11 подключаются два датчика DS18b20!
Получается у нас с трех датчиков идет съем информации или как?
Последний раз редактировалось dimonvlg Чт июн 28, 2018 12:13:24, всего редактировалось 1 раз.
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

dimonvlg писал(а):У-32 С подключен ds18b20
П-28 С подключен 3231
H-0%
P-758 подключен BMP280

У-ds18b20(температура на улице)
П-BME280(температура помещения)
H-BME280(влажность помещения)
P-BME280(давление)

У BMP280 термометр и барометр, гигрометра нет.

Добавлено after 9 minutes 18 seconds:
[uquote="dimonvlg",url="/forum/viewtopic.php?p=3409313#p3409313"]Получается у нас с трех датчиков идет съем информации или как?[/uquote]
В пятой версии температура берется только с ds18b20.
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

max50, можно прошивку v5 выложить?
Аватара пользователя
max50
Мучитель микросхем
Сообщения: 497
Зарегистрирован: Ср дек 10, 2008 21:24:28
Откуда: Алтайский край, Барнаул

Re: Не скучные часы на WS2812B

Сообщение max50 »

Её выкладывал Mishany, я пока не проверял.
Того, кто не задумывается о далеких трудностях, ожидают близкие неприятности.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Mishany, выкладывал 24 июня (на 10 странице) архив, но там V4!

Я залил ее, там опрос с 3231.
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Mishany, выложите пожалуйста V5! (если конечно не коммерческая версия).
Аватара пользователя
jn79
Опытный кот
Сообщения: 821
Зарегистрирован: Ср окт 10, 2007 10:54:35
Откуда: Омская обл
Контактная информация:

Re: Не скучные часы на WS2812B

Сообщение jn79 »

забрал контроллер
по какой схеме делать плату ?
Аватара пользователя
dimonvlg
Открыл глаза
Сообщения: 40
Зарегистрирован: Пн сен 13, 2010 21:43:59
Откуда: Волгоград

Re: Не скучные часы на WS2812B

Сообщение dimonvlg »

Я делал плату от max50, все работает! Mishany, выкладывал на предыдущей.
Аватара пользователя
Mishany
Электрический кот
Сообщения: 1031
Зарегистрирован: Чт июн 20, 2013 00:00:58
Откуда: москва, м.Сходненская

Re: Не скучные часы на WS2812B

Сообщение Mishany »

Я уже выкладывал V5, не обращайте внимания на то, что внутри написано))))

Код: Выделить всё

void read_DATE(void)
{
   read_temperature(6);
   read_temperature(7);

вот считывание температуры с портов PD6 и PD7, скопировал из main.c
развели тут панику :sleep: :)))
перепроверить пока не могу т.к. жена забраковала провода, на которых висят датчики, ей ВОНЯЕТ...
датчики на работе ждут проводов не вонючих, часы где то на балконе...
Nikolos25
Родился
Сообщения: 1
Зарегистрирован: Чт июл 12, 2018 00:44:34

Re: Не скучные часы на WS2812B

Сообщение Nikolos25 »

Изображение
ребята прошу помощи, уже какой вечер бьюс с часами, все спаял правильно 10 раз проверил, заливал разные скечи хотябы для теста часов, но после загрузки светодиоды не загораются, тупо тишина, пробовал сет таейм скеч для 3231 но в мониторе порта пусто. тестовые фаст лед
фекты работают нормально. помогите плиззз.
еще есть момент могли ли часы реального времени сгореть, если я КЗ сделал и одна ардуино надо сгорела))))) а на второй теперь тишина
PS часы делал 4 светика на сегмент из отрезков светодиодной по 4 диода. на мигание +2 диода
Аватара пользователя
Mishany
Электрический кот
Сообщения: 1031
Зарегистрирован: Чт июн 20, 2013 00:00:58
Откуда: москва, м.Сходненская

Re: Не скучные часы на WS2812B

Сообщение Mishany »

сдается мне что подключено все на абум диоды должны подключены к D11; кнопки к A0, A1, A2; фоторезистор на A7 т.д.
Изображение
ВОПРОС чем вы руководствовались при подключении?
дуриновская либа управлением WS2812 реализована ногодрыгом, у меня аппаратный SPI и жестко привязан к периферии МК порту PB3 на дуриек это D11 вывод.
Ответить

Вернуться в «AVR»